3. Nursing Homes and Assisted Living Facilities:
Many nursing homes and assisted living facilities in Nashville offer free CNA training programs to individuals who are interested in working in long-term care settings. These facilities often have a high demand for CNAs and are willing to invest in training and developing new talent. By participating in a free training program at a nursing home or assisted living facility, you’ll not only receive hands-on experience but also have the opportunity to secure employment upon completion of the program.
